Step 2: Set a Realistic Kitchen Renovation Budget

Kitchen remodels can range from $10,000 (basic upgrades) to $75,000+ (luxury renovations), depending on the scope of work. Setting a budget ensures you prioritize essentials while avoiding unnecessary expenses.

Cost Breakdown for a Kitchen Remodel:

🏡 Cabinetry & Hardware: 30-35%
🏡 Countertops & Surfaces: 15-20%
🏡 Appliances & Fixtures: 15-20%
🏡 Flooring & Walls: 10-15%
🏡 Labor & Installation: 20-30%

How to Save Money:

Refinish existing cabinets instead of replacing them.
Shop during sales for appliances and fixtures.
Choose mid-range materials that balance quality and cost.
Avoid unnecessary customizations—they increase costs significantly.

🔹 Pro Tip: Allocate 10-20% of your budget for unexpected expenses, such as plumbing or electrical issues.

Step 4: Choose a Functional Kitchen Layout

The layout of your kitchen determines its functionality and efficiency.

Most Popular Kitchen Layouts:

🏡 L-Shaped Kitchen: Great for open-concept spaces, providing ample counter space.
🏡 U-Shaped Kitchen: Ideal for larger kitchens, offering plenty of cabinets and storage.
🏡 Galley Kitchen: Best for small spaces, maximizing efficiency with two parallel counters.
🏡 Island Kitchen: Adds seating, storage, and workspace for food prep and entertaining.

🔹 Pro Tip: Follow the kitchen work triangle rule, ensuring the stove, sink, and refrigerator are efficiently positioned for ease of movement.

Step 5: Select Materials and Finishes

Choosing the right materials, colors, and finishes can define the look and durability of your kitchen.

Countertops:

Quartz—Low maintenance, durable, and stylish.
Granite—Heat-resistant and elegant but requires sealing.
Butcher Block—Warm and natural but needs regular upkeep.

Cabinetry:

Shaker-style cabinets—Timeless and versatile.
Flat-panel cabinets—Modern and sleek.
Glass-front cabinets—Perfect for showcasing dishware.

Flooring:

Luxury Vinyl Plank (LVP)—Water-resistant and budget-friendly.
Tile Flooring—Durable and easy to clean.
Hardwood—Adds warmth but requires maintenance.

🔹 Pro Tip: Choose neutral colors for resale value but add personality with a bold backsplash or unique hardware.

Step 7: Prepare for Kitchen Construction & Demolition

Kitchen remodels take 4-8 weeks, depending on the scope of work.

How to Prepare:

✅ Set up a temporary kitchen with a microwave, fridge, and essentials.
✅ Expect noise, dust, and disruptions—plan accordingly.
✅ Keep kids and pets away from the work zone.
✅ Confirm permit approvals before construction begins.

🔹 Pro Tip: Order materials before demolition to prevent delays in the timeline.
